About State Archives
Overview of State Archives and their role in the Public Sector and Society
State Archives are institutions that preserve important documents and records for government entities at the state level. They play a crucial role in maintaining transparency in government operations as well as providing access to historical materials that help people understand their heritage. The archives hold documents such as birth and death certificates, property deeds, court records, and photographs. The archives are also tasked with preserving other significant materials such as maps, artwork, and artifacts that are integral to the state’s history.Historical significance and preservation of documents and records
State archives hold vast collections of documents and records that tell the story of the state's history. These documents and records are preserved and made available to the public for historical research and study. The archives are responsible for ensuring that these documents and records are properly stored, catalogued, and made accessible to the public. This is done through a variety of preservation techniques, including digitization, microfilming, and restoration.Access to public records and information
State archives provide access to public records and information to the public. These archives maintain records related to individuals, businesses, and organizations that are often used for background checks or genealogical research. The archives provide access to these records to individuals, researchers, and government agencies alike. Many of the records that archives hold are open to the public, and they can be accessed online or in person.Services provided by State Archives, including research assistance and educational programs
State archives provide a range of services to the public. Researchers can access resources such as historical documents, maps, and photographs. The archives often provide assistance to help researchers find the specific information they need. They also provide educational programs, including lectures, tours, and workshops, to help the public understand the significance of the state's history.Importance of State Archives in legal proceedings and genealogical research
State archives provide critical information for genealogical research, helping individuals trace their family histories and backgrounds. They also provide vital information in legal proceedings, such as land title disputes or estate settlements. Historical records held by archives can provide valuable evidence in legal cases, providing a window into the past that can be used to understand important legal issues.Challenges faced by State Archives, such as digitization and funding limitations
State archives face a number of challenges in their work. One of the biggest challenges is digitization, as many archives have vast collections of historical materials that are not available online. Digitizing these records can be a significant undertaking and require a significant investment of time and resources. Funding limitations can also make it difficult for archives to carry out their work effectively, as they rely on state or government funding or donations from the public to continue their operations.Collaborations and partnerships with other organizations for preservation and access to historical materials
State archives often partner with other organizations and groups to help preserve and make accessible the historical materials they hold. These partnerships can include historical societies, libraries, and museums, among others. By working together, these organizations can provide a more comprehensive understanding of the state's history and ensure that important records and information are made available to the public.Future of State Archives and their evolving role in the digital age
The future of state archives is likely to be shaped by advancements in technology and the increasing demand for access to historical materials online. Archives will likely continue to digitize their collections and make them available through online portals, allowing researchers to access materials from anywhere in the world. Archives may also begin to incorporate interactive features and tools to make it easier for researchers to find the information they need. As the role of state archives evolves, they will continue to play a critical role in preserving the state's history and making it accessible to future generations.
